From 178f62a60f4d34ccfe83e81452d5c84fab7e5045 Mon Sep 17 00:00:00 2001 From: xuxiuxi <xuxiuxi@454eff88-639b-444f-9e54-f578c98de674> Date: 星期四, 25 五月 2017 17:35:52 +0800 Subject: [PATCH] --- VisitFace/DemoForBsk/app/src/main/res/layout/load_more.xml | 2 +- /dev/null | 35 ----------------------------------- V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/DeviceMng.java | 16 +++++++++++----- V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/fragment/SurveillanceFragment.java | 2 +- V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/discern/common/BaseCommonCallBack.java | 5 +++++ 5 files changed, 18 insertions(+), 42 deletions(-) di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/discern/common/BaseCommonCallBack.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/discern/common/BaseCommonCallBack.java index c5d84c7..e16c108 100644 ---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/discern/common/BaseCommonCallBack.java +++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/discern/common/BaseCommonCallBack.java @@ -11,6 +11,7 @@ import org.xutils.ex.HttpException; import java.net.ConnectException; +import java.net.SocketTimeoutException; import java.util.List; public abstract class BaseCommonCallBack implements Callback.CommonCallback<ResultBean>{ @@ -58,6 +59,10 @@ @Override public void onError(Throwable ex, boolean isOnCallback) { + if (ex instanceof SocketTimeoutException) { + Toast.makeText(BaseApplication.getInstance(), "socket杩炴帴瓒呮椂", Toast.LENGTH_SHORT ).show(); + return; + } if (ex instanceof ConnectException) { Toast.makeText(BaseApplication.getInstance(), "鏈嶅姟鍣ㄨ繛鎺ュけ璐�", Toast.LENGTH_SHORT ).show(); return; di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/fragment/SurveillanceFragment.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/fragment/SurveillanceFragment.java index b907669..e103581 100644 ---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/fragment/SurveillanceFragment.java +++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/fragment/SurveillanceFragment.java @@ -81,7 +81,7 @@ } else { useNative = true; } - useNative = false; + //useNative = false; if (useNative) { System.loadLibrary("cvface_api"); System.loadLibrary("opencv_java3"); di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/DeviceMng.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/DeviceMng.java index 1f50ccf..ed676f0 100644 ---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/DeviceMng.java +++ b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/service/DeviceMng.java @@ -22,7 +22,7 @@ public class DeviceMng { public static DeviceMng instance = new DeviceMng(); - public static String authorationId = null; + public static String authorationId = "101"; public static DeviceMng getInstance() { return instance; @@ -50,10 +50,16 @@ public void load () { try { - if (authorationId == null || authorationId.trim().length() <= 1) { - getAuthorationId(); - return; - } +// if (authorationId == null || authorationId.trim().length() <= 1) { +// getAuthorationId(); +// MainActivity.getInstance().runOnUiThread(new Runnable() { +// @Override +// public void run() { +// Toast.makeText(MainActivity.getInstance(), "璇峰~鍐欒澶囧簭鍒楀彿", Toast.LENGTH_SHORT).show(); +// } +// }); +// return; +// } RequestParams params = new RequestParams(AppApi.BASE_URL + AppApi.Query.DEVICE_QUERY); params.addBodyParameter(Device.FieldNames.authorizationId, authorationId); x.http().post(params, new BaseCommonCallBack() { diff --git a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/widget/checkin/TextViewExtension.java b/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/widget/checkin/TextViewExtension.java deleted file mode 100644 index abc052d..0000000 --- a/VisitFace/DemoForBsk/app/src/main/java/cn/com/basic/face/widget/checkin/TextViewExtension.java +++ /dev/null @@ -1,35 +0,0 @@ -package cn.com.basic.face.widget.checkin; - -import android.content.Context; -import android.widget.TextView; - -public class TextViewExtension extends TextView { - - -protected OnVisibilityChange mChangeListener = null; - - public interface OnVisibilityChange{ - void onChange(TextViewExtension mTextView , int mPrevVisibility , int mNewVisibility); - } - - public TextViewExtension(Context context) { - super(context); - // TODO Auto-generated constructor stub - } - - /* (non-Javadoc) - * @see android.view.View#setVisibility(int) - */ - @Override - public void setVisibility(int visibility) { - // TODO Auto-generated method stub - super.setVisibility(visibility); - if(mChangeListener != null){ - mChangeListener.onChange(this, getVisibility() , visibility); - } - } - - public void setOnVisibilityChange(OnVisibilityChange mChangeListener ){ - this.mChangeListener = mChangeListener; - } -} \ No newline at end of file diff --git a/VisitFace/DemoForBsk/app/src/main/res/layout/load_more.xml b/VisitFace/DemoForBsk/app/src/main/res/layout/load_more.xml index c359182..65cff9d 100644 --- a/VisitFace/DemoForBsk/app/src/main/res/layout/load_more.xml +++ b/VisitFace/DemoForBsk/app/src/main/res/layout/load_more.xml @@ -4,7 +4,7 @@ android:layout_height="wrap_content" xmlns:app="http://schemas.android.com/apk/res-auto" android:orientation="vertical"> - <cn.com.basic.face.widget.checkin.TextViewExtension + <TextView android:id="@+id/load_more_text_view" android:paddingTop="@dimen/h20dp" android:paddingBottom="@dimen/h20dp" -- Gitblit v1.8.0